Transaction c64599eccce183bfa9c5a87367022addcf425a8fb1a2f5121dd4e4f84b233012
1 Input
1 Output
-
c64599eccce183bfa9c5a87367022addcf425a8fb1a2f5121dd4e4f84b233012:0
- value
- 4971879
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d540ce4f39e68176675dc7e7f072954078a767cd OP_EQUAL
- address
- 3M8bVCLTAmgzsyTTV9jqsgzd79MRev7bor